Hieronymus Bosch Bacon comes in the form of a range of outline human figures, stamped out of flat areas of bacon rashers,(vegan of course) using a variety of pastry cutter shapes. Their facial features also consist of very simple cut away slots for the eyes, nostrils and mouth.

Toss them unto a hot oiled griddle, and watch as they fry.

Take a few pics of your own version of an Hieronymus Bosch depiction of hell in a frying pan. Create a website and invite the best examples to compete for an award.
